A man has been hospitalised following a collision on the Irish Rail line in Tullamore this afternoon.
The man was injured when a train struck a tractor crossing the line at Meelaghans, Tullamore, at 3.50pm.
Crew and emergency services were called to the scene.
A garda spokesperson said: “A male has been conveyed to hospital for treatment of injuries believed to be non-life-threatening at this time.”
In a post on X, Irish Rail said that bus transfers have left Portarlington and will travel to Athlone, where passengers can transfer onto a train service.
“More buses are being arranged,” a spokesperson said.
